How they compare

Macao currently reports 99.2% against 80.1% in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an, a difference of 19.1%.

That makes Macao's figure about 1.2 times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an's.

Across all 8 years both countries report, Macao has been ahead every year.

Macao ranks 26th and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an ranks 25th of 164 countries.

Macao has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Macao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an Difference Ahead
2000s 98.5% 76.5% 22.1% Macao
2010s 99.6% 79.3% 20.3% Macao
2020s 99.2% 80.7% 18.4% Macao

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Persistence to last grade of primary is the percentage of children enrolled in the first grade of primary school who eventually reach the last grade of primary education. The estimate is based on the reconstructed cohort method.
